Heaven on Earth Cake

Section: Festive Flavors Year Round

This dessert features airy angel food cake layered with vibrant cherry filling and enveloped in a smooth mix of milk, cream, sour cream, and thickened vanilla pudding. A whipped topping layer adds lightness, while sliced almonds provide a gentle crunch. Chilling melds the flavors perfectly, resulting in a creamy, fruity, and textured delight that’s simple to prepare but richly satisfying.

Harper
Contributed by Harper
Last updated on Wed, 28 Jan 2026 10:11:16 GMT
A slice of Heaven on Earth cake. Save
A slice of Heaven on Earth cake. | flavorrhaven.com

This Heaven on Earth Cake is the perfect dessert for special occasions or any time you want a light yet indulgent treat. Layers of airy angel food cake, tangy cherry pie filling, creamy pudding, and fluffy whipped topping create a harmony of textures and flavors that always impress. It comes together without complicated baking, making it a crowd-pleaser that feels homemade without hours in the kitchen.

I first made this for a family reunion, and it quickly became the dessert everyone asked me to bring. It feels like a little slice of heaven each time.

Ingredients

  • Angel food cake: fourteen ounces provides a light, airy foundation opt for a fresh cake with a soft texture
  • Cherry pie filling: twenty-one ounces brings a bright, fruity tartness and some moisture that soaks into the cake layers nicely
  • Whole milk: one cup forms the creamy base of the pudding mixture choose fresh and whole for the best flavor
  • Heavy cream: half cup adds richness and body to the pudding
  • Sour cream: one cup contributes subtle tang and creaminess enhancing flavor complexity
  • Instant French vanilla pudding mix: three point four ounces thickens the cream mixture with a vanilla flavor go for a quality brand for smooth texture
  • Whipped topping: eight ounces thawed lightens the dessert and adds fluffy creaminess
  • Thinly sliced almonds: one and a half tablespoons add crunch and a nutty finish select fresh almonds for maximum crunch

Instructions

Slicing the Cake:
Slice the angel food cake into one inch cubes. This size lets it absorb layers of flavor without becoming mushy. Place half the cubes evenly in the bottom of a nine by nine inch baking dish creating a sturdy but tender base.
Layering Cherry Pie Filling:
Spoon approximately two thirds of the canned cherry pie filling over the cake cubes with care. The cherries add bright color and juicy sweetness that seeps into the cake.
Adding More Cake:
Evenly arrange the remaining half of the cake cubes over the cherry layer creating structure for the creamy layers to come.
Combining Cream Base:
In a medium mixing bowl combine the whole milk, heavy cream, and sour cream. Whisk or use a handheld mixer on low speed until smooth and fully incorporated.
Incorporating Pudding Mix:
Sprinkle the instant French vanilla pudding mix over the cream base. Continue whisking or low speed mixing until the pudding mixture begins to thicken and reaches about the consistency of yogurt.
Spreading Pudding Layer:
Spread the thickened pudding evenly over the last cake cube layer to introduce a smooth creamy element that binds the dessert.
Adding Whipped Topping:
Spread the thawed whipped topping over the pudding layer, distributing gently to keep it fluffy and airy.
Swirling Cherry Topping:
Dollop the remaining cherry pie filling on top of the whipped topping layer. Use a spoon, kitchen knife, or bamboo skewer to gently swirl a decorative pattern blending cherries slightly into the cream.
Finishing with Almonds:
Sprinkle the thinly sliced almonds evenly over the top to add texture and a lovely nutty aroma.
Chilling the Dessert:
Cover the dish tightly with plastic wrap and chill in the refrigerator for at least four hours. The flavors will meld and deepen over time creating the best possible taste. Keep it refrigerated until ready to serve.
A slice of a cake with white frosting and cherries on top.
A slice of a cake with white frosting and cherries on top. | flavorrhaven.com

One of my favorite parts of this recipe is the contrast between the light cake and the crunchy almond topping. Growing up, my grandmother made variations of this with seasonal fruits and I can still remember sneaking bites before dinner.

Storage Tips

Keep any leftovers covered tightly in the refrigerator. This cake holds up nicely for two to three days without losing moisture or flavor. Bringing it to room temperature before serving helps the pudding shine.

Ingredient Substitutions

You can swap sour cream for Greek yogurt if preferred for a similarly tangy profile. Fresh cherry pie filling can replace canned for less sweetness and fresher fruit taste. Coconut whipped cream works well for a dairy-free version but changes texture slightly.

Serving Suggestions

Serve heaven on earth cake chilled with a cup of coffee or tea. Garnish with fresh mint leaves or additional sliced almonds for extra visual appeal. This dessert pairs beautifully with light sparkling wines or fruity white wines at dinner parties.

A slice of Heaven on Earth cake.
A slice of Heaven on Earth cake. | flavorrhaven.com

This dessert balances lightness and indulgence perfectly making it a memorable treat for any occasion.

FAQs about Recipes

→ What type of cake is best for this dish?

Angel food cake works best due to its light and airy texture, which soaks up the creamy and fruity layers without becoming heavy.

→ Can I use fresh cherries instead of canned cherry filling?

Fresh cherries can be used, but they should be cooked down with sugar to mimic the texture and sweetness of canned filling for proper consistency.

→ How long should this dessert be chilled?

Chilling for at least 4 hours is recommended to allow the layers to meld, enhancing flavor and texture.

→ Is it possible to substitute the pudding mix?

Instant French vanilla pudding mix provides specific flavor and thickness; alternatives may change texture and taste, so use similar vanilla pudding for best results.

→ What is the purpose of the sliced almonds on top?

Thinly sliced almonds add a subtle crunch and toasty flavor that complements the creamy and fruity layers beneath.

→ Can this dessert be made ahead of time?

Yes, preparing it a day ahead helps the flavors blend beautifully and makes serving easier.

Heaven on Earth Cake

Layered angel food cake with cherry filling, creamy vanilla pudding, and whipped topping finished with almonds.

Prep Time
20 mins
Cooking Time
~
Overall Time
20 mins
Contributed by: Harper

Recipe Category: Holiday Specials

Skill Level: Beginner-Friendly

Cuisine Type: American

Recipe Output: 9 Portion Size

Dietary Features: Vegetarian-Friendly

What You'll Need

→ Base

01 14 ounces store-bought angel food cake

→ Fruit Filling

02 21 ounces canned cherry pie filling

→ Dairy Mixture

03 1 cup whole milk
04 ½ cup heavy cream
05 1 cup sour cream

→ Pudding

06 3.4 ounces instant French vanilla pudding mix

→ Topping

07 8 ounces whipped topping, thawed
08 1½ tablespoons thinly sliced almonds

Step-by-Step Guide

Step 01

Slice the angel food cake into 1-inch cubes. Evenly arrange half of the cubes in the bottom of a 9x9-inch baking dish.

Step 02

Spoon approximately two-thirds of the cherry pie filling evenly over the cake cubes.

Step 03

Place the remaining angel food cake cubes uniformly atop the cherry filling.

Step 04

In a medium bowl, whisk together whole milk, heavy cream, and sour cream until fully blended.

Step 05

Sprinkle the instant French vanilla pudding mix over the dairy blend. Whisk continuously until the mixture thickens to a yogurt-like consistency.

Step 06

Evenly spread the thickened pudding mixture over the top layer of cake cubes.

Step 07

Carefully spread the thawed whipped topping over the pudding layer.

Step 08

Dollop the remaining cherry pie filling onto the whipped topping. Using a spoon, knife, or skewer, gently swirl to create a marbled effect.

Step 09

Sprinkle the thinly sliced almonds evenly across the top of the cherry filling layer.

Step 10

Cover the dish with plastic wrap and refrigerate for at least 4 hours to allow flavors to meld. Keep chilled until ready to serve.

Additional Notes

  1. Longer chilling enhances flavor melding and texture.

Tools You'll Need

  • 9x9-inch baking dish
  • Medium mixing bowl
  • Whisk or handheld mixer
  • Spoon or bamboo skewer
  • Plastic wrap

Allergen Notices

Inspect every ingredient for potential allergens and seek expert advice if necessary.
  • Contains dairy, almonds, and gluten

Per Serving Nutritional Info

Keep in mind these are general guidelines, not a replacement for professional advice.
  • Calories: 320.5
  • Fats: 12.7 grams
  • Carbohydrates: 48.2 grams
  • Proteins: 5.3 grams